(II) Two polarizers A and B are aligned so that their transmissionaxes are vertical and horizontal, respectively. Athird polarizer is placed between these two with its axisaligned at angle 6 with respect to the vertical. Assumingvertically polarized light of intensity /0 is incident upon polarizerA, find an expression for the light intensity I transmittedthrough this three-polarizer sequence. Calculate the derivativedl/d0\ then use it to find the angle 6 that maximizes I.
